Here you go. The gaming benchmarks are 120 second Fraps benchmarks. Cinebench 11.5 OpenGL 63.09 fps Cinebench 11.5 CPU 4.49 pts. 3DMark 11 P5567 Borderlands 2 Maxed Out Min - 35 fps Avg - 70 fps Max - 105 fps Far Cry 3 Ultra Min - 28 fps Avg - 30 fps Max - 32 fps GTA IV Maxed Out Sliders 50% Min - 27 fps Avg - 36 fps Max - 55 fps Also the CPU is running around 35 degrees Celsius according to Core Temp, and the GPU is around 65 according to GPU Tweak.
